The 12371 / 12372 Howrah–Jaisalmer Superfast Express is a Superfast Express train of the Indian Railways connecting Howrah Junction in West Bengal and Jaisalmer of Rajasthan. It is currently being operated with 12371/12372 train numbers on a weekly basis.[1][2][3]
Service[edit | edit source]
The 12371/Howrah–Jaisalmer Superfast Express has an average speed of 57 km/h and covers 2249 km in 39 hrs 25 mins. 12372/Jaisalmer–Howrah Superfast Express has an average speed of 57 km/hr and covers 2249 km in 39 hrs 25 mins.

Coach composition[edit | edit source]
The train has got LHB rakes from 26 August 2019, with max speed of 130 km/h. The train consists of 24 coaches:
- 1 First AC
- 1 AC II Tier
- 4 AC III Tier
- 11 Sleeper coaches
- 3 General
- 2 Second-class Luggage/parcel van
- 1 High capacity parcel van
- 1 Pantry car
Traction[edit | edit source]
Both trains are hauled by a Howrah-based WAP-4 electric locomotive from Howrah to Mughalsarai Junction and from Mughalsarai Junction it is hauled by a Mughalsarai-based WDM-3A diesel locomotive up til Jaisalmer and vice versa.
